    HBASE-27095 HbckChore should produce a report
    
    In #4470 for HBASE-26192, it was noted that the HbckChore is kind of a pain to use and test
    because it maintains a bunch of local state. By contract, the CatalogJanitorChore makes a nice
    self-contained report. Let's update HbckChore to do the same.
